The steel industry is entering a new era with the inauguration of the first Scope 1 zero-emission rolling mill by FERALPI STAHL in Riesa. This facility marks a significant step towards sustainability, with an investment exceeding 220 million euros, the largest ever made by the company in Germany.
The new facility not only promises to reduce the environmental impact of steel production but also creates job opportunities in the region, generating over 100 new industrial jobs in Saxony.
Technological Innovations in the Rolling Mill
The “spooler” rolling mill features an advanced technological system that enables continuous rolling through the welding of billets. Equipped with zero-emission induction furnaces, this facility utilizes a 300-meter-long roller path to connect directly to the existing continuous casting plant. Thanks to this innovation, the production process occurs without direct CO2 emissions, thus contributing to the decarbonization of the steel industry.
With this cutting-edge technology, it will be possible to produce heavy coils weighing up to eight tons, setting new standards in the steel market.
A Positive Signal for the Local Economy
Michael Kretschmer, Minister President of Saxony, emphasized the importance of the investment, stating: “The investment in the new spooler rolling mill demonstrates the company’s confidence in Saxony as an industrial location.” He also highlighted the need for favorable conditions for industries to continue thriving and undergoing technological transformation.
Giuseppe Pasini, president of the Feralpi Group, reiterated the company’s commitment to investing in sustainable technologies to enhance competitiveness in the global market. He stressed the importance of collaboration with German and European political institutions to address crucial issues such as energy costs and the recognition of scrap metal as a strategic raw material.
Comprehensive Modernization Plan
The new rolling mill is part of a broader project aimed at modernizing existing facilities. In addition to the construction of the rolling mill itself, improvements are planned for facilities dedicated to scrap preparation and the establishment of a new electrical substation. These enhancements will make the recycling process more efficient and facilitate the integration of renewable energies into daily operations.
Uwe Reinecke, General Manager of FERALPI STAHL, stated: “With the launch of the new rolling mill, we are concretely realizing the vision of green steel.” This commitment extends beyond innovative technologies to also enhancing the human resources involved in industrial transformation.
The Feralpi Group: A Sustainable Leader
The Feralpi Group is one of the leading steel producers in Europe, recording a revenue of 1.7 billion euros in 2023. With over 1,900 direct employees and a specialization in the production of steel for construction and specialized applications, the company continues to invest in environmental respect and economic sustainability.
